Phần mở rộng tệp là gì?

Tác giả sysadmin, T.M.Một 05, 2022, 06:01:11 CHIỀU

« Chủ đề trước - Chủ đề tiếp »

0 Thành viên và 1 Khách đang xem chủ đề.

Phần mở rộng tệp là gì?


Phần mở rộng tệp, hoặc phần mở rộng tên tệp, là một hậu tố ở cuối tệp máy tính. Nó xuất hiện sau dấu chấm và thường dài từ hai đến bốn ký tự. Nếu bạn đã từng mở tài liệu hoặc xem ảnh, chắc hẳn bạn đã nhận thấy những chữ cái này ở cuối tệp của mình.


Phần mở rộng tệp được hệ điều hành sử dụng để xác định những ứng dụng nào được liên kết với loại tệp nào — nói cách khác, ứng dụng nào sẽ mở ra khi bạn nhấp đúp vào tệp. Ví dụ: một tệp có tên "awesome_picture.jpg" có phần mở rộng là "jpg". Ví dụ: khi bạn mở tệp đó trong Windows, hệ điều hành sẽ tìm kiếm bất kỳ ứng dụng nào được liên kết với tệp JPG, mở ứng dụng đó và tải tệp.

1. Có những loại tiện ích mở rộng nào?

Có nhiều loại phần mở rộng tệp khác nhau — quá nhiều để liệt kê trong một bài báo — nhưng đây là một vài ví dụ về phần mở rộng tệp phổ biến mà bạn có thể thấy trên máy tính của mình:

  • DOC / DOCX:   Một tài liệu Microsoft Word. DOC là phần mở rộng ban đầu được sử dụng cho các tài liệu Word, nhưng Microsoft đã thay đổi định dạng khi Word 2007 ra mắt. Các tài liệu Word hiện dựa trên định dạng XML, do đó có thêm chữ "X" ở cuối phần mở rộng.
  • XLS / XLSX:  Một bảng tính Microsoft Excel.
  • PNG:  Đồ họa Mạng Di động, một định dạng tệp hình ảnh không mất dữ liệu.
  • HTM / HTML:  Định dạng Ngôn ngữ Đánh dấu Siêu văn bản để tạo các trang web trực tuyến.
  • PDF:   Định dạng Tài liệu Di động do Adobe tạo ra và được sử dụng để duy trì định dạng trong các tài liệu được phân phối.
  • EXE: Một định dạng thực thi được sử dụng cho các chương trình bạn có thể chạy.

Và như chúng tôi đã nói, đây chỉ là một phần nhỏ của các phần mở rộng tệp ngoài đó. Đúng là có hàng ngàn.

Cũng cần lưu ý rằng có những loại tệp ngoài kia vốn có rủi ro và có thể nguy hiểm. Thông thường, đây là các tệp thực thi có thể chạy một số loại mã nhất định khi bạn cố gắng mở chúng. Chơi an toàn và không mở tệp trừ khi chúng đến từ một nguồn đáng tin cậy.

2. Điều gì xảy ra nếu tôi không thấy phần mở rộng tệp trên tệp của mình?

Theo mặc định, Windows hiển thị phần mở rộng tệp. Trong một thời gian — trong Windows 7, 8 và thậm chí 10 — điều này không đúng, nhưng may mắn thay, họ đã thay đổi cài đặt mặc định. Chúng tôi nói thật may mắn vì chúng tôi cảm thấy việc hiển thị phần mở rộng tệp không chỉ hữu ích hơn mà còn an toàn hơn. Nếu không có phần mở rộng tệp hiển thị, có thể khó phân biệt liệu tệp PDF bạn đang xem (ví dụ) có thực sự là tệp PDF hay không và không phải tệp thực thi độc hại nào đó.

Nếu phần mở rộng tệp không hiển thị cho bạn trong Windows, chúng đủ dễ dàng để bật lại. Trong bất kỳ cửa sổ File Explorer nào, chỉ cần đi tới View> Options> Change folder and search options. Trong cửa sổ Tùy chọn Thư mục, trên tab "Xem", bỏ chọn hộp "Ẩn tiện ích mở rộng cho các loại tệp đã biết".


Phần mở rộng tệp không hiển thị trên máy Mac theo mặc định. Lý do cho điều này là macOS không thực sự sử dụng các tiện ích mở rộng giống như cách Windows làm (và chúng ta sẽ nói về điều đó nhiều hơn trong phần tiếp theo).

Tuy nhiên, bạn có thể làm cho máy Mac của mình hiển thị phần mở rộng tệp và có lẽ bạn không nên làm như vậy. Với Finder đang mở, chỉ cần đi tới Finder> Preferences> Advanced, sau đó bật hộp kiểm "Hiển thị tất cả phần mở rộng tên tệp".


3. MacOS và Linux sử dụng tiện ích mở rộng tệp như thế nào?

Vì vậy, chúng ta đã nói về cách Windows sử dụng phần mở rộng tệp để biết loại tệp mà nó xử lý và ứng dụng nào sẽ sử dụng khi bạn mở tệp. Windows biết rằng tệp có tên readme.txt là tệp văn bản do có phần mở rộng tệp TXT đó và nó biết cách mở tệp đó bằng trình soạn thảo văn bản mặc định của bạn. Xóa phần mở rộng đó và Windows sẽ không biết phải làm gì với tệp nữa.

Mặc dù macOS và Linux vẫn sử dụng phần mở rộng tệp, nhưng chúng không dựa vào chúng như Windows. Thay vào đó, họ sử dụng một thứ gọi là loại MIME và mã người tạo để xác định tệp là gì. Thông tin này được lưu trữ trong tiêu đề của tệp và cả macOS và Linux đều sử dụng thông tin đó để xác định loại tệp mà chúng đang xử lý.

Vì phần mở rộng tệp không thực sự bắt buộc trên macOS hoặc Linux, bạn rất có thể có tệp hợp lệ không có phần mở rộng, nhưng hệ điều hành vẫn có thể mở tệp bằng chương trình phù hợp do thông tin tệp có trong tiêu đề tệp.

Chúng tôi sẽ không đi sâu hơn vào vấn đề này ở đây, nhưng nếu bạn muốn tìm hiểu thêm, hãy xem hướng dẫn của chúng tôi về lý do tại sao Linux và macOS không cần phần mở rộng tệp.

4. Điều gì sẽ xảy ra nếu tôi thay đổi phần mở rộng của tệp?

Dựa trên những gì chúng ta vừa nói trong phần trước, điều gì sẽ xảy ra khi bạn thay đổi loại phần mở rộng của tệp phụ thuộc vào hệ điều hành bạn đang sử dụng.

Trong Windows, nếu bạn xóa phần mở rộng tệp, Windows không còn biết phải làm gì với tệp đó. Khi bạn cố gắng mở tệp, Windows sẽ hỏi bạn muốn sử dụng ứng dụng nào. Nếu bạn thay đổi tiện ích mở rộng — giả sử bạn đổi tên tệp từ "coolpic.jpg" thành "coolpic.txt" —Windows sẽ cố gắng mở tệp trong ứng dụng được liên kết với tiện ích mở rộng mới và bạn sẽ nhận được thông báo lỗi hoặc một tệp đã mở, nhưng vô dụng,. Trong ví dụ này, Notepad (hoặc bất kỳ trình soạn thảo văn bản mặc định của bạn là gì) đã mở tệp "coolpic.txt" của chúng tôi, nhưng đó chỉ là một mớ văn bản bị cắt xén.


Vì lý do đó, Windows sẽ cảnh báo bạn bất cứ khi nào bạn cố gắng thay đổi phần mở rộng của tệp và bạn phải xác nhận hành động.


Nếu bạn đang sử dụng macOS, điều tương tự cũng xảy ra. Bạn vẫn nhận được thông báo cảnh báo nếu bạn cố gắng thay đổi phần mở rộng của tệp.


Nếu bạn thay đổi tiện ích mở rộng thành một thứ khác, macOS sẽ cố gắng mở tệp trong ứng dụng được liên kết với tiện ích mở rộng mới. Và, bạn sẽ nhận được thông báo lỗi hoặc tệp bị cắt xén — giống như trong Windows.

Điều khác biệt so với Windows là nếu bạn cố gắng xóa phần mở rộng của tệp trong macOS (ít nhất là trong Finder), macOS sẽ chỉ thêm phần mở rộng tương tự trở lại ngay, sử dụng dữ liệu từ loại MIME của tệp.

Nếu bạn thực sự muốn thay đổi loại tệp — ví dụ: bạn muốn thay đổi hình ảnh từ định dạng JPG sang PNG — bạn cần sử dụng phần mềm thực sự có thể chuyển đổi tệp.

5. Cách thay đổi chương trình mở tệp

Bất cứ khi nào bạn cài đặt một ứng dụng có thể mở một loại tệp cụ thể, ứng dụng đó và phần mở rộng tệp sẽ được đăng ký với hệ điều hành của bạn. Hoàn toàn có thể có nhiều ứng dụng có thể mở cùng một loại tệp. Bạn có thể kích hoạt một ứng dụng, sau đó tải bất kỳ loại tệp nào được hỗ trợ vào đó. Hoặc, bạn có thể nhấp chuột phải vào tệp để mở menu ngữ cảnh của nó và chọn một ứng dụng có sẵn ở đó.

Ví dụ: trong hình ảnh bên dưới, bạn có thể thấy rằng chúng tôi có một số ứng dụng hình ảnh trên hệ thống Windows của chúng tôi có thể mở tệp "coolpic.jpg" mà chúng tôi đã nhấp chuột phải.


Tuy nhiên, cũng có một ứng dụng mặc định được liên kết với mỗi tiện ích mở rộng. Đó là ứng dụng mở ra khi bạn nhấp đúp vào tệp và trong Windows, ứng dụng này cũng xuất hiện ở đầu danh sách mà bạn nhận được khi nhấp chuột phải vào tệp (IrfanView trong hình trên).

Và bạn có thể thay đổi ứng dụng mặc định đó. Chỉ cần đi tới Cài đặt> Ứng dụng> Ứng dụng mặc định> Chọn ứng dụng mặc định theo loại tệp. Cuộn qua danh sách (rất dài) các loại tệp để tìm loại tệp bạn muốn, sau đó nhấp vào ứng dụng hiện được liên kết ở bên phải để thay đổi. Hãy xem hướng dẫn đầy đủ của chúng tôi để đặt các ứng dụng mặc định của bạn trong Windows để biết thêm thông tin.


Và bạn có thể làm điều tương tự trên máy Mac của mình. Chỉ cần chọn loại tệp bạn muốn thay đổi, sau đó chọn Tệp> Nhận thông tin từ menu chính. Trong cửa sổ Thông tin bật lên, hãy đi tới phần "Mở bằng", sau đó sử dụng menu thả xuống để chọn một ứng dụng mới. Vừa đủ dễ.